Full Description

The following text is from the original listed building designation:
1. 5273 BISHOPSBOURNE PARK LANE (north side)
Nos 3 and 4 TR 1852 21/140
II GV
2. Formerly one Cl8 building. One storey and attic in brick with tiled roof with 3 gabled dormers. No 3 is of one and a half storeys and attic, with a window of 2 lights above a window of 3 lights, casements. No 4 has a window of 3 lights and one of 2 lights, casements to the single storey. Modern doors, wood lintels. No 4 has C18 panelled interior.
